City of Palo Alto Sheet No. California Cancelling Sheet No. APPLICABILITY: UTILITY RATE SCHEDULE SCHEDULE G-1 GENERAL NATURAL GAS SERVICE This· schedule applies to all firm natural gas service. TERRITORY: Within the service area of the City of Palo Alto and on land owned or leased by the City. Lifeline rates are applicable on).y to residential usage. 2.
